.\" Copyright (c) 1990, 1991, 1993 .\" The Regents of the University of California. All rights reserved. .\" .\" This code is derived from software contributed to Berkeley by .\" the Systems Programming Group of the University of Utah Computer .\" Science Department. .\" .\" %sccs.include.redist.man% .\" .\" @(#)ppi.4 8.1 (Berkeley) 06/09/93 .\" .Dd .Dt PPI 4 hp300 .Os .Sh NAME .Nm ppi .Nd .Tn HP-IB printer/plotter interface .Sh SYNOPSIS .Cd "device ppi0 at hpib0 slave 5" .Sh DESCRIPTION The .Nm ppi interface provides a means of communication with .Tn HP-IB printers and plotters. .Pp Special files .Pa ppi0 through .Pa ppi7 are used to access the devices, with the digit at the end of the filename referring to the bus address of the device. Current versions of the autoconf code can not probe for these devices, so the device entry in the configuration file must be fully qualified. .Pp The device files appear as follows: .Bd -literal -offset indent "crw-rw-rw- 1 root 11, 0 Dec 21 11:22 /dev/ppi" .Ed .Sh DIAGNOSTICS None. .Sh SEE ALSO .Xr hpib 4 . .Sh BUGS This driver is very primitive, it handshakes data out byte by byte. It should use .Tn DMA if possible.